CPA Exam Requirements

Education Requirements

Credit Requirements: 150 semester units (225 quarter units)

Minimum Degree: Baccalaureate with 150 semester units

Additional Requirements: 30 Semester hours or equivalent quarter hours in accounting or auditing, including 15 hours completed in-person; excluding finance courses; and no more than 3 hours in business law


Residency Requirements

Citizenship: U.S. Citizenship is not required

Minimum Age: 18

Additional Requirements: It is not necessary to be a resident, employee, or keep office(s) in the state

State License Requirements

Social Security Requirement: Yes

Educational Requirement: 150 Semester hours (including Bachelor’s Degree) with 30 hours in accounting

Participates in International Exam Program: Yes

Experience Requirements: 1 year experience of part time or full time, paid or volunteer work experience supervised by a licensed CPA, completed in government, industry, academia, or public practice within a time period of 1-3 years. Must be obtained in the 7 years leading up to taking the CPA Exam, or within 7 years after passing the CPA Exam, and be documented using the Work Experience Verification form.

Ethics Exam: Must pass AICPA Professional Ethics Exam

CPA Fees

Initial Application Fees $180
AUD $224.99
BEC $224.99
FAR $224.99
REG $224.99
Total $1079.96

   *Re-examination application fee varies
